Ohio's climate presents a dual challenge for HVAC systems. Scorching summers demand efficient air conditioning, while frigid winters require reliable furnaces. Common AC issues include refrigerant leaks and compressor strain, while furnace problems often involve ignitor failures or blower motor malfunctions. Ohio's licensing requirements for HVAC technicians ensure a baseline of competence, but understanding local building codes and the prevalence of older housing stock with varied insulation levels is crucial for effective repairs.

What is the most common problem of a furnace?

The most frequent furnace problems in Ohio often involve ignition issues or a faulty thermostat, especially in homes with older heating systems. Wear and tear can also lead to problems with the blower motor or heat exchanger. Regular inspections are vital for preventing these common failures.
